Home fo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ve assessing the condition of the foundation, identifying problem areas such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ting, and then implementing solutions to restore stability. Techniques may include under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, all aimed at preventing further damage and ensuring the safety of the structure.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ment and methods to reinforce or rebuild compromised foundation elements, helping to maintain the overall health of the property.
Problems that foundation repair services help solve include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Left unaddressed, foundation problems can lead to more severe structural damage, costly repairs, or compromised safety. By resolving these issues early, property owners can protect their investments and maintain the value of their homes or commercial buildings.
Properties that typically need foundation repair services range from single-family homes and townhouses to larger residential complexes and commercial structures. Older homes are more prone to foundation issues due to settling over time, while newer constructions may experience problems related to soil conditions or construction defects. Both concrete slab foundations and pier-and-beam systems can benefit from professional repair services, ensuring stability regardless of property size or type.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ods. Smaller repairs, such as crack injections, may be closer to $2,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000.
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s for foundation repair usually fall between $1,000 and $5,000, with labor charges adding another $1,000 to $3,500. The total cost varies based on the foundation type and site accessibility.
Scope of Repair - Minor foundation crack repairs generally cost between $500 and $1,500, whereas major underpinning or leveling projects can range from $10,000 to over $20,000. The complexity of the work influences the overall expense.
Factors Influencing Cost - Costs vary depending on foundation size, soil condition, and whether additional structural work is needed. Local service providers can offer estimates based on specific property assessments in Harrisonville, MO, and nearby areas.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window frames or exterior doors.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but many projects can be completed within a few days to a week after assessment by local contractors.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ional evaluation can determine if the cracks are superficial or indicate underlying issues that need attention.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Common methods include pier and beam adjustments, slab jacking, wall stabilization, and underpinning, depending on the foundation type and problem severity.
How can I pr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age around the property, maintaining consistent moisture levels in the soil, and addressing plumbing leaks promptly can help reduce the risk of future foundation problems.
